**Join Our Team as a Infant/Toddler Teacher!** Are you ready to impact children's lives? At Head Start, we are committed to providing quality education and care for children and their families. Central Missouri Community Action is hiring Infant/Toddler Teachers for our Head Start center in **Columbia**, and we want you to join our team! As a nurturing Teacher, you will positively influence the lives of children aged infant to 3 years old, fostering their growth and development through evidence-based early childhood education. **Position:** Infant/Toddler Teacher **Pay:** $15.27 to $16.31 per hour **Job Duties:** - Ensure positive guidance when interacting with children. - Ensure a secure, health-conscious, and well-organized setting to accommodate the needs and requirements of infants and toddlers. - Maintain the health and safety of children under the care of CMCA - Create and maintain a nurturing environment where both children and parents feel comfortable and welcome. **Job Requirements:** - CDA or some college required. Related College degree preferred. - Daycare, preschool, or childcare work experience is helpful. - Prefer experience working with low-income families and children. - Experience with integrating Early Childhood Development theory into daily classroom activities preferred. - Tailor approaches to meet the individual needs of the children. **Benefits:** - Generous paid time off, including 10 paid holidays - Excellent medical, dental, life, and vision insurance - Retirement Plan - 4-day work week (Tuesday - Friday) - Two week paid winter break - Opportunities for advancement - Professional development opportunities - CMCA swag and spirit! **Schedule:** - 10 hour shift, Tuesday through Friday **ABOUT CENTRAL MISSOURI COMMUNITY ACTION (CMCA)** CMCA is part of a national network of community action agencies founded in 1964. Our mission is to build relationships to empower people, strengthen resilience, and improve the quality of life for all members of the community. The actions of our organization change people's lives, embody the spirit of hope, improve communities, and make America a better place to live. We care about the entire community, and we are dedicated to helping people help themselves and each other. We have over 230 staff members throughout eleven counties.
